Suesette Bernice Larson, 70
On Saturday, June 30, 2012, Suesette Bernice Larson (nee Laverdure) passed away peacefully at the age of 70 years. She is survived by four children: Len, Brian (Michelle), Steve (Kim), Leanne (Kevin House); her grandchildren Dennis, Corinna, Travis and Coleton; sister Phyllis (Ron) Olson; brother Bill (Cheryl) Laverdure; as well as numerous nieces and nephews; and close friends.
She dearly loved her family. Friends and family enjoyed her loving compassionate heart.
Mom will be fondly remembered for her love of life. She enjoyed gardening, baking, fishing, camping knitting and music. She instilled in us her great wisdom, understanding and respect.
And while she lies in peaceful sleep, Her memory we shall always keep.
Family and friends will be received at the Northridge Funeral Home, Emo, Ontario on Thursday July 5, 2012 from 1-3 p.m. Funeral mass will be held on Friday July 6, 2012 at 11:30 a.m. from Our Lady of Good Counsel Catholic Church, Pinewood, Ontario. Father Alan Albao Celebrant. Interment will take place in Forest Lawn Cemetery, Rainy River, Ontario.
